NFL Week 4: Minnesota Vikings vs. Carolina Panthers betting picks, preview

These are a couple of 0-3 teams. For Carolina, not much was expected coming into the season thanks to a rookie starting quarterback and a coach in his first year with the team. However, Minnesota has to be feeling the heat and wondering whether they should trade their veteran QB and start over. This is the second week in a row the Vikings are playing a winless opponent. 

Minnesota Vikings vs. Carolina Panthers Betting Trends and Odds 

Sunday, Oct. 1, 2023 - 1 p.m. ET

Odds: Minnesota -4.5, Over/under 46.5, Minnesota -210 | Carolina +170

It tells you a lot about what the markets think of Carolina that they are underdogs at home against a winless team. (I think I wrote the same thing about Minnesota last week ... haha). I do think Minnesota is the better side, but it is a hard team to get comfortable with right now. This number is in the dead zone too with Minnesota taking up the significant majority of the tickets and the cash.

Picks for Minnesota vs. Carolina

Minnesota -4.5, T.J. Hockenson TD Scorer (+145)

These are a couple of winless teams so it is really hard to know what we have on either side. With Minnesota, there is definitely more proof of concept with the head coach and quarterback and they have one of the best weapons in the league in receiver Justin Jefferson. There is debate whether top pick QB Bryce Young will suit up for Carolina this week. His backup is Andy Dalton, who is a great player to have in that role, should they need him again, but I am not going to trust him to outduel Kirk Cousins. Not with the weapons that Cousins has available to him. Minnesota makes sense as the favorite and as the side to back on Sunday afternoon. 

Tight end T.J. Hockenson is one of those weapons and probably one of the more underrated players at the position. He has not caught less than seven balls in a game this season and has a couple of TD passes. He is the most productive TE the Panthers have faced this season and should get into the end zone this week (along with Jefferson) in a game featuring multiple scores.

This line looks like it will only go up, but sitting in that weird in-between range it probably won't matter, except for in your teasers.
